Understanding Your 2016 Kia Sorento Wiring Diagram
At its core, a 2016 Kia Sorento wiring diagram is a visual representation of the electrical pathways within your vehicle. Think of it as a schematic blueprint, meticulously detailing every wire, connector, fuse, relay, and component involved in the electrical system. It shows how these elements are interconnected, allowing electricity to flow and power everything from your headlights to your anti-lock braking system. These diagrams are not just random lines; they use standardized symbols to represent different electrical parts, making them universally understandable to anyone familiar with electrical principles.
The utility of a 2016 Kia Sorento wiring diagram extends to a variety of essential tasks. For mechanics, it's a vital diagnostic tool. When a particular system isn't functioning correctly, the diagram helps pinpoint the exact location of the problem. Is a fuse blown? Is a wire damaged? Is a relay malfunctioning? The diagram provides the answers. For enthusiasts, it can be used for upgrades or custom installations, ensuring that any modifications are performed correctly and safely. For instance, consider the table below outlining a simplified look at a basic circuit:
| Component | Function | Connection Point Example |
|---|---|---|
| Battery | Provides electrical power | Main power input |
| Fuse | Protects the circuit from overcurrent | Connects between battery and load |
| Switch | Controls the flow of electricity | Interrupts the circuit to turn a device on/off |
| Light Bulb | Converts electrical energy to light | The device being powered |
This simple example illustrates how even basic circuits are clearly laid out in a wiring diagram, allowing for methodical inspection and repair.
